The SC19083 package contains three functions and all homeworks. The three functions are Equity_after_shock, CI_BCa_Bootstrap and Metropolis. Equity_after_shock is used to calculate the residual equity of banking system after a certain external shock using R. CI_BCa_Bootstrap is used to calculate the BCa confidence interval through bootstrap method using R. Metropolis is A random walk Metropolis sampler for generating the standard Laplace distribution using Rcpp.

The above code can calculate the residual owner's equity of the banking network after the shock. We use the method in "A Bayesian Methodology for Systemic Risk Assessment in Financial Networks" to calculate the interbank debt matrix(function sample_ERE in R packges systemicrisk). We use the method in "Distress and default contagion in financial networks" to calculate the equity matrix after the external shock.

The source R code for CI_BCa_Bootstrap is as follows:
CI_BCa_Bootstrap <-function(x, conf) { # x the sample # conf confidence level x <- as.matrix(x) n <- nrow(x) N <- 1:n alpha <- (1 + c(-conf, conf))/2 zalpha <- qnorm(alpha) cov.hat<-cov(x) lamda.hat<-eigen(cov.hat)$values lamda.sum<-sum(lamda.hat) th0<-lamda.hat[1]/lamda.sum B<-2000 th<-numeric(B) for(b in 1:B){ i <- sample(1:n, size = n, replace = TRUE) scor.boot<-scor[i,] cov.boot<-cov(scor.boot) lamda.boot<-eigen(cov.boot)$values th[b]<-lamda.boot[1]/sum(lamda.boot) } z0 <- qnorm(sum(th < th0) / length(th)) scor.jack<-x[-1,] theta.jack<-numeric(n) for(i in 1:n){ scor.jack<-scor[-i,] cov.jack<-cov(scor.jack) lamda.jack<-eigen(cov.jack)$values theta.jack[i]<-lamda.jack[1]/sum(lamda.jack) } L <- mean(theta.jack) - theta.jack a <- sum(L^3)/(6 * sum(L^2)^1.5) adj.alpha <- pnorm(z0 + (z0+zalpha)/(1-a*(z0+zalpha))) limits <- quantile(th, adj.alpha, type=6) return(list("est"=th0, "BCa"=limits)) # a list including the sample estimate and BCa confidence interval }
The above code can estimate BCa confidence interval with Bootstrap using R.

The source Rcpp code for Metropolis is as follows:
NumericVector Metropolis(double sigma, double x0, int N){ #x0: the initial point #sigma: the standard deviation in the normal distribution #N: the length of the chain NumericVector x(N); x[0]=x0; for (int i=1;i<N;i++) { double e=runif(1)[0]; double z=rnorm(1,x[i-1],sigma)[0]; if (e<=exp(abs(x[i-1])-abs(z))) x[i]=z; else { x[i]=x[i-1]; } } return x; }
example:
library(SC19083) N<-100 sigma<-1.0 x0<-0.0 Metropolis(sigma,x0,N)
